How To Choose The Best Soil Amendments For Clay Soil

The wrong amendment can lock up nutrients or fail to penetrate at all. You need to match the amendment’s specific chemical action to your soil’s current pH and your plant’s needs.

Calcium Content vs. pH Impact

Gypsum adds calcium and sulfur without altering pH, making it the go-to for alkaline clay. Lime also adds calcium but raises pH, which is disastrous for acid-loving plants. Always check whether your target amendment forces a pH shift you don’t want.

Particle Size and Solubility

Fine powders (solution grade) penetrate compacted clay within weeks because they dissolve immediately upon watering. Pelletized or granular versions are easier to spread but may take months to break down enough to reach the root zone. For quick results on hard clay, choose a micronized or water-soluble form.

Trace Mineral Profile vs. Macronutrient Focus

Some amendments like azomite provide over 70 trace minerals that rebuild nutrient-holding capacity in worn-out clay. Others, like sulfur, target a single chemical correction (pH lowering). Match the breadth of minerals to your soil test — a simple NPK deficiency may need gypsum; barren, lifeless clay may need a full spectrum of trace elements.

Hardware & Specs Guide

Calcium Sulfate Content (Gypsum)

The percentage of calcium sulfate dihydrate determines how much calcium and sulfur you’re actually delivering to the clay. Greenway’s 97% purity means near-zero filler, while pelletized gypsum products typically run 80-85% pure. Higher purity is critical when using gypsum to correct blossom-end rot or flush sodium from saline clay, as you need maximum calcium per pound without excess inert material.

Particle Size and Solubility

Solution-grade powders (<50 mesh) dissolve fully in water within minutes, making them suitable for fertigation and immediate soil injection. Pelletized granules (2-4 mm) require soil moisture and microbial activity to break down, typically becoming bioavailable in 4-8 weeks. For compacted clay that needs rapid improvement, select a powder; for maintenance applications on already-loosened clay, pellets offer longer release and easier spreader handling.

pH Impact Profile

Gypsum has a neutral pH effect (it adds calcium without releasing hydroxyl ions). Elemental sulfur has a strong acidifying effect (each pound can lower pH by roughly 1.0 unit on 100 sq ft of loam, adjusted for clay’s buffer capacity). Azomite is near-neutral (pH 7.0-8.0). Choosing the wrong pH profile can lock up iron or molybdenum for years, so match the amendment to your current soil test before applying.

Trace Mineral Diversity

Azomite provides over 70 trace minerals including rare earth elements (REE) like cerium and lanthanum, which are absent in standard fertilizers. Clay soils that have been farmed for years are often depleted in these trace elements, leading to invisible yield gaps. A full-spectrum mineral amendment restores the entire micronutrient profile without requiring multiple single-element products.

FAQ

Can I use gypsum and elemental sulfur at the same time on clay soil?
Yes, but only if your soil test confirms both low calcium and high pH. Gypsum adds calcium without pH shift; sulfur lowers pH. Applying both simultaneously can create a temporary chemical imbalance in the root zone. It’s safer to apply gypsum first, wait 4-6 weeks, test pH, then apply sulfur only if needed. Never mix them into a single application.
How long does it take for gypsum to break up clay soil?
Solution-grade powder gypsum shows drainage improvement in 2-3 weeks when watered in regularly. Pelletized gypsum takes 4-8 weeks to fully break down, though initial water penetration often improves within the first month. Soil temperature matters — microbial activity that degrades the pellets slows below 55°F, so spring applications work faster than fall.
Will azomite change the pH of my clay soil?
No. Azomite has a near-neutral pH of 7.0-8.0 in its natural state and does not contain calcium carbonate or other alkalizing agents. It can be safely applied to both acidic and alkaline clay soils without risking a pH lockout. This makes it the safest option if you don’t yet have a soil test but want to start rebuilding mineral content immediately.
How much sulfur do I need to lower clay soil pH by 1 point?
Clay soils have high buffering capacity, meaning they resist pH changes far more than sandy soils. A general rule is 4-6 pounds of elemental sulfur per 100 square feet to lower pH by 1 full point in clay loam. Always apply in two split doses 4-6 weeks apart and retest before adding more. Over-application can drop pH below 5.0, which mobilizes toxic aluminum.
